Rick Spangle wrote:
Hi, got a CF GPS for my Pocket pc PDA running Tomtom Nav5, problem is locking on & staying on a signal, i often (eventually) get 1 bar on the strength but occasionally go upto 4 but its straight back down again, is there any programs to boost the GPS or do i just get on with it.
It doesnt have any brand logo on it but it connects to my Generic CF Slot.


Those have pretty small antennas generally. There's no easy way to boost the signal strength to its built in antenna. The make some re-radiating GPS antennas will receive, amplify, and rebroadcast GPS signal but I have no experience with them.

Take that out side and give it the best sky view (towards the equator generally) for a while and see if you can get a number of bars at good signal strength. Then you can move it around slowly while watching the bars and see how directional it is. Too directional can be a bad thing.

Some of the CF models have an external antenna jack, one of the cheap generic antennas on eBay can make a big difference. The externals are amplified generally and may shorten your battery life a little.
